Navigating the World of Property Bonds: Opportunities and Considerations
Property bonds present a attractive avenue for investors seeking to diversify their portfolios. These securities offer the potential of attractive returns while providing exposure to the real estate market. However, before diving into this investment realm, it's crucial to carefully consider both the benefits and challenges.
One key merit of property bonds is their potential to generate steady income through regular coupon payments. This can be particularly attractive for investors seeking a reliable source of passive earnings. Moreover, property bonds often exhibit reduced correlation with traditional asset classes, such as stocks and bonds. This spreading can help mitigate overall portfolio exposure.
However, it's essential to recognize the inherent risks involved in property bond investments. The value of these securities can fluctuate based on factors such as interest rate movements, real estate market conditions, and the financial health of the underlying property developer. Therefore, high yield property bonds investors should conduct thorough research before committing capital.
It's prudent to diversify your investment holdings across multiple asset classes and consult with a qualified financial advisor to determine if property bonds align with your specific investment goals and risk tolerance. By carefully navigating the opportunities and considerations associated with property bonds, investors can potentially enhance their portfolio returns while managing risk.
